Ember Months: Osun Amotekun Commander, Omoyele Vows Zero Tolerance for Crime

… Corps arrest suspected criminals

THE Corps Commander of Osun Amotekun Corps, Dr Omoyele Isaac Adekunle, has Vowed zero tolerance for Crime in the nooks and crannies of the state, while it has arrested suspects for various alleged crimes.

The Osun Amotekun boss gave the assurance while parading the suspects before newsmen at the corps headquarters in Osogbo, state capital on Tuesday.

Adekunle said that the suspects were arrested for offences including alleged shop breakers, phone snatchers, POS Terminals attackers, burglary and stealing, Motorcycle theft and Goat stealing.

He said all arrested suspects will be transferred to the appropriate authority for prosecution and vowed to follow up.

The Amotekun Corps Commander said that the corps would not relent in its efforts to rid the state of criminal elements.

He also said that, the Governor Ademola Adeleke’s led administration in Osun was resolute in its determination to ensure that investors, residents and commuters moved about freely in the state without apprehension of attacks by hoodlums.

According to Adekunle, “We want to reassure the people of Osun State that Amotekun is intact in the entire state and we will continue our 24-hour patrol.

“We shall continue to track all criminals from the town to Forest reserves and ensure that travellers are not molested. “I am reassuring the general public that my leadership would minimize crime and optimize resources available, ensure collaboration with other security agencies and the public to maintain peace and order during this ember months all over Osun State” Osun Amotekun boss said.

The Osun Amotekun Commander who warned criminal minded people to stay away from Osun, said that he was determined to ensure swift responses to distress calls by residents of the state. He called on the people of Osun to always supply credible information to the Corps to ensure a crime free environment.
